Responsibilities
  • Implement and maintain a consistent framework on interest rate risk of Banking Book ("IRRBB") and liquidity risk management and control process.
  • Establish and review IRRBB and liquidity risk policies which are in line with the group practices.
  • Lead the team to prepare, monitor and analyze IRRBB and / or liquidity risk reports (e.g. IRRBB, PV01, MCO, LCR, or NSFR) and ensure all exposures be properly captured in ALM system
  • Lead the team to maintain the ALM system, develop user requirement in IRRBB and / or liquidity risk for system replacement and participate in new system acceptance tests
  • Prepare presentation materials for monthly ALCO and quarterly RMC meetings
  • Provide guidance and oversight to junior staff
  • Work with Head Office to review the behavioralisation models applied in measuring IRRBB, liquidity risk, or FTP
  • Be responsible for SDST and ICAAP in the area of IRRBB and / or liquidity risk including relevant ICAAP stress tests
